Paediatric First Aid Print

 

Course Details

The course provides theoretical and practical training in First Aid techniques that are specific to infants aged 0 to 1, and children aged from 1 year old to the onset of puberty.

Course Description

Candidates will become familiar with the role of the paediatric first aider and be able to assess and react appropriately to an emergency situation including being able to provide first aid for a child and an infant who;

  • is unresponsive
  • has an airway obstruction
  • is suffering from shock
  • is wounded and bleeding
  • has a fracture or dislocation
  • has a head, neck or back injury
  • has a condition effecting the eyes, ears or nose
  • has a chronic medical condition or sudden illness
  • is experiencing the effects of extreme heat and/or cold
  • has been poisoned
  • has been bitten or stung
  • has sustained an electric shock

The Level 2 Award in Paediatric First Aid consists of 2 units and is to be provided over a period of 2 days with a minimum contact time of 6 hours per unit. 

We can offer a 1 day course covering Unit 1 of the qualification. Candidates successfully completing only the 1 day course will gain a Credit Certificate only, not the full Level 2 Award in Paediatric First Aid.

For the purposes of Registered Childcare provision and Early Years childcare within England, Wales and Northern Ireland, the Candidate must successfully complete the full 2 day Level 2 Award in Paediatric First Aid.

The Statutory Framework for the Early Years Foundation Stage is a document published by The Department for Children, Schools and Families and applies to Early Years childcare within England, Wales and Northern Ireland. The Statutory Framework states that ‘at least one person who has a current paediatric first aid certificate must be on the premises at all times when children are present. There must be at least one person on outings who has a current paediatric first aid certificate.’ The HABC Level 2 Award in Paediatric First Aid is recognised as a qualification that fulfills this need.

Qualification Information:


Designed for: Parents, child minders, nannies, nursery school staff and anyone registered with OFSTED.

Course duration: 12 hours
Assessment methods: ongoing assessment and multiple choice examination.
Certification: Highfield Awarding Body for Compliance (HABC) Level 2 Award in Paediatric First Aid.
